重庆大学计算机基础系列课程
实 验 报 告 本
课程名称 计算机信息管理基础
实验学期 2010 年至 2011 年 第 1 学期
学生所在学院 材料学院
年级 2009级 专业班级 材料加工1班
学生姓名 陈余波 学号
指导教师 熊心志
实验最终成绩
计算机学院基础系制
实验题目
实验一:建立复杂的数据模型
实验时间
2010年10月11日
实验地点
DS1402
实验成绩
实验性质
□验证性 √□设计性 □综合性
教师评价:
□思路正确 □内容完整 □方案过程正确 □实验结果正确 □报告规范
其他:
一、实验目的
(1) 熟悉工具S-Designer 的数据建模基本功能及其基本操作过程,能熟练使用S-Designer进行复杂的数据建模。
(2) 通过实验,加强对数据建模的理解,深刻理解数据建模的作用。?
二、实验主要内容和要求
(1) 根据教材2.2.2建立仓库管理E-R模型。
(2) 利用S-Designor绘制CDM。
(3) 从CDM生成PDM。
(4) 从PDM生成SQL脚本代码。
(5) 分别生成CDM和PDM报告。.1.
.1.
三、实验主要步骤或过程
(1) 给出CDM,PDM以及生成的SQL脚本。(3个文件)
(2) 写出建立CDM,从CDM到PDM的转换、以及生成的SQL脚本的步骤。(1个文件)
(3) 给出生成的CDM和PDM报告。(2个文件)
四、实验结果(题解或运行结果)
见”\\server02\熊心志余波材料学院材料加工专业信管1
五、实验分析或总结
通过老师的指导操作,体会S-Designer中建立实体及其关系的过程,在多次建立实体的过程中熟悉该过程。更改属性,建立int.char.float的数据类型已在实验过程中熟练操作,实现一对一,一对多的联系,建立对数据建模的基础知识。通过creat report等操作,熟悉建立repoet的word文档以及脚本文件的过程。在不断建立各种关系及其文档的过程,熟练对复杂数据模型的建立,加强了对数据建模的理解,及其形象化描述关系的作用。
不足之处:
1.数据联系的对应关系错误的建立成为一对一而实际为多对多。
2只有转换成PDM后才能生成SQL脚本。
3.数据类型的字节数设置有错及格式有错。
4.在对两个不同实体属性定义时不能输入相同的属性。
改进之处:
在该过程中仔细体会联系的实际的对应关系,体会实体间的联系,要仔细。
注意字段名对应的格式,并认真处理每一步的联系。
仔细阅读课本以更加深刻理解实验内容。
实验题目
实验二:建立完整的DFD
实验时间
2010年10月17日
实验地点
DS1402
实验成绩
实验性质
□验证性 □√设计性 □综合性
教师评价:
□思路正确 □内容完整 □方案过程正确 □实验结果正确 □报告规范
其他:
一、实验目的
(1) 深刻理解DFD的概念及其在项目开发中的作用。
(2) 理解DFD各种对象(实体、数据流、数据存储)所表达的含义。
(3) 熟悉S-Designor ProcessAnlys的基本功能及其基本操作过程,熟练使用S-Designor绘制较复杂的DFD。
二、实验主要内容和要求
(1) 根据教材图3.19建立“库存管理信息系统”的数据流程图模型DFD。
(2) 利用S-Designor ProcessAnlyst, 根据系统功能建立实体、处理和数据存储。
(3) 在实体与处理、处理与数据存储之间添加数据流。
(4) 为有数据项的部件(数据流及数据存储)添加数据项。.1.
.1.
三、实验主要步骤或过程
(1) 绘制该DFD,包括各部件的描述,数据流的数据项及数据存储的数据项。
(2) 给出数据待建立对象的文字描述。
(3) 给出建立实体、处理、数据流、数据存储等对象的操作过程。
(4) 给出修改对象(Properties), 如 Definition、Description等的步骤。
(5) 为有数据项( Data Item)的部件,如数据流( Flow) 添加数据项的步骤。
(6) 生成该DFD数据流程图模型的word格式文档报告。
四、实验结果(题解或运